Mutations of the ANG gene in French patients with sporadic amyotrophic lateral sclerosis.
Archives of neurology - 1 Oct 2008
Paubel Agathe, Violette Jeremy, Amy Maïté, Praline Julien, Meininger Vincent, Camu William, Corcia Philippe, Andres Christian R, Vourc'h Patrick
Abstract excerpt
BACKGROUND: Mutations in the angiogenin gene, ANG, have been associated recently with familial and sporadic forms of am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S). However, the cellular and molecular mechanisms that link ANG, a multidomain protein, to ALS are still unknown. OBJECTIVE: To assess the frequency of ANG gene mutations in 855 French patients with sporadic ALS. DESIGN: We analyzed by direct sequencing the full...
